| Building on his education in both areas of
orchestral composition and synthetic development, Derek Devore is currently
developing complex compositions built entirely in the computer language C
fused with the developmental environment of Csound. Using this process, Derek
is able to synthetically reproduce many sounds in the natural world being
rendered and reproduced entirely by computer. The results are compositions
that breathe with a natural ambience that, when used in conjunction,
supplement the modern orchestra.

Programmed completely in the language of
Csound, this work aims to create a thematic relationship between what is
orchestral and what is purely synthetic.
